The Audition

This game is all about imbuing meaning in a specific character and personality — a happy, fun, silly, light party game.

You are all Actors trying to impress the Director with your acting chops. Each round, you’ll receive three cards: a Line card, a Character card, and a Personality card. Your job is to communicate your Character and Personality by saying that line – each one from a classic Shakespeare play. Players score points every time the Director correctly picks the Character and Personality a player had.

Cosmic Cheddar Chase

2-6 players – 20-30 minutes – 8 and up
Design by Chris Backe and Simon Russell
Gateway action selection and investing

“I haven’t seen a cheese crisis like this since the Great Cheddar Catastrophe of ‘85.
The line for cheese is longer than ever and the Rodent Republic government is in talks about even further rationing. But there’s hope…

In Cosmic Cheddar Chase, you are cheese merchants that will help the three teams of animals making their way to the moon (which as we all know is made of cheese!). Take actions to supply and invest in the teams, and score points when the team you’ve invested in is in the lead. When one team reaches the moon, the game ends and the player with the most successful investments wins.

Transylvanian Lottery

A worker placement game where you rig the lottery! Selected for Fastaval 2022 in Denmark, and won 2nd place in the audience vote.

It’s the 317th annual Grand Transylvanian Lottery, and all sorts of prizes are available! Every Transylvanian resident gets an entry, but you’ve found a way to rig the lottery to win (or avoid) the various prizes. During the rigging phase, move your entries around the Transylvanian Castle to add, move, or remove entries from the various bags. During the lottery phase, score prizes to earn points. Watch out for the curses!

Who Shot the Sheriff?

No moderator is needed (everyone plays), there’s no eye-closing, and no one is eliminated!

Someone shot the Sheriff… but they didn’t shoot the Deputy! Together with an Accomplice, the Murderer got away. The Judge has called the Deputy and other members of the community to convene a jury. The Murderer and Accomplice have joined the jury to ensure the finger gets pointed at someone else…

Each game, players draw a role card (telling you who you are) and a team card (indicating what team you’re on). Team Good Guys want to catch the Murderer or an Accomplice, team Murderer wants to ensure the Murderer gets away, while team Accomplice wants to ensure the Accomplice get away.
